Exterior Design Changes 2025 Hyundai Tucson
Hyundai has given the 2025 Tucson a facelift, which enhances it’s features and make it even more catchy to the public. The update grille has larger illuminated elements, making the car look somewhat more fierce. The new design also has new front and rear bumpers and the wheels currently go up to 19 inches from the factory.
One of the more practical upgrade is the removal of the rear wiper blade and the newly raised roof side rails on the XRT models.

The 2025 Tucson offers several powertrain options, providing the consumer with more options. There is the standard 2.5-liter inline-4 gas engine (187 horse power and 170+ lbs of torque) with a 8-speed automatic transmission. This will give you north of 20 MPG in the city and over 30 MPG on the highway but your mileage will vary depending on driving habits (take it from me!)
For those who want to save money on gas, Hyundai also offers the 2025 Tucson as a hybrid and Plug-In Hybrid variations. The hybrid model has a 1.6-liter turbocharged gas engine with an electric motor, which delivers over 200 horsepower.
Meanwhile, the plug-in hybrid also utilizes the same engine mentioned above but adds a more powerful electric motor, which results in over 260 horsepower and 250 lbs of torque. Safety and Convenience Technologies in the new 2025 Hyundai Tucson
Standard safety technologies including automated emergency braking with pedestrian detection, lane-departure warning, lane-keep assist, adaptive cruise control with lane centering features will all remain in the 2025 Tucson.
However, the 2025 variant will also have a Forward Attention Warning, which will use an infrared camera to monitor driver attention levels. If the driver is determined to not be responsive then the smart cruise control will safely bring the car to stop.
The car will also have the fingerprint sensor for added security to vehicle start, digital key for key-fob-free access to the vehicle, and automatic A/C system shutdown. These features will continue to keep drivers safe behind the wheels and also add additional and convenient tools for drivers to utilize.
Top Reasons to Purchase 2025 Tucson over the 2024 model
Enhanced Exterior Design
- The 2025 Tucson features a refreshed grille with larger illuminated elements, updated front and rear bumpers, and new alloy wheels ranging from 17 to 19 inches, giving it a more aggressive and modern look.
Upgraded Infotainment System
- The new dual 12.3-inch screens for the gauge cluster and infotainment system offer a sleek, unified design. The upgraded system provides faster processing speeds, better visuals, and improved usability with more physical buttons and knobs.
Wireless Connectivity
- Wireless Android Auto and Apple CarPlay integration are now standard across all trims, eliminating the need for cables and enhancing convenience for drivers.
Advanced Safety Features
- The 2025 Tucson includes Forward Attention Warning (FAW) with an infrared camera to monitor driver attention and Smart Cruise Control 2 that can bring the vehicle to a stop if the driver is unresponsive. These new safety features add an extra layer of protection.
Fingerprint Authentication Sensor
- This new feature allows for secure vehicle start and access, providing an added level of convenience and security that wasn’t available in the 2024 model.
Improved Rear Visibility
- The 2025 model comes with a longer rear wiper blade, enhancing visibility during adverse weather conditions, a subtle but significant improvement over the 2024 version.
Updated Interior Storage and Comfort
- The redesigned center console includes a new wireless charging pad and a practical storage shelf facing the front passenger, offering more convenience and usability.
Expanded Driver Assistance Technologies
- The 2025 Tucson offers an expanded suite of driver-assistance technologies, including automated emergency braking with pedestrian detection, lane-departure warning with lane-keeping assist, and adaptive cruise control with a lane-centering feature, enhancing safety and driving ease.
Refined Driving Experience
- The 2025 Tucson provides a quieter and more refined driving experience, with driver-adjustable levels of regenerative braking in the hybrid and plug-in hybrid models for improved control and comfort.
All-Wheel Drive Standard on Hybrids
The hybrid and plug-in hybrid variants now come standard with HTRAC all-wheel drive, ensuring optimal traction and stability, making them a more versatile and attractive option for buyers in various driving conditions.
